What companies run services between Kimpton Clocktower Hotel, England and Old Trafford Cricket Ground, England?

Bee Network operates a bus from Oxford Road Station to Greatstone Road every 15 minutes. Tickets cost £2 and the journey takes 18 min. Alternatively, Metrolink operates a vehicle from St Peter's Square to Old Trafford every 10 minutes. Tickets cost £1–3 and the journey takes 12 min.
